守护闪兑:TPWallet实时支付故障的深度剖析与高性能修复路径

摘要:TPWallet无法闪兑通常是实时支付链路、第三方清算、或者系统并发控制环节出现瓶颈或策略拦截所致。本文从实时支付处理、高效能技术、智能化数据平台、Golang实践与系统审计五大维度,给出可操作的分析流程与改进建议,基于行业标准与权威文献支撑。

实时支付处理:实时支付要求低延迟、幂等性与强一致性。常见阻断点包括网关超时、外部清算方限流、签名/证书失效与风控规则触发。遵循ISO 20022与PCI DSS治理,可保证报文规范与安全合规[1][2]。

高效能技术应用:采用Golang并发模型、gRPC+Protobuf、无阻塞IO与线程池设计,结合Kafka/NATS做异步削峰,可显著提升TPS并降低响应尾延迟。Redis/L1缓存与本地热点缓存减少同步依赖,压力测试(基于K6或JMeter)验证伸缩能力[3][4]。

智能化数据平台与专业见地:构建流式平台(Kafka+Flink/Beam),实时指标、CEP规则与ML异常检测,可在交易链路早期识别失败模式并触发回滚或降级。监控链路需覆盖业务指标、系统指标与追踪链路(Prometheus/Grafana + Jaeger)以便快速定位。

Golang与系统审计:Golang因其轻量协程与稳定性能成为支付后端优选语言。结合分布式追踪与可审计的不可变日志(WORM或Kafka topic+签名),满足事后审计与合规查证要求。审计流程应包含日志收集、存证、溯源与证据链管理,遵循NIST/企业合规最佳实践[2][5]。

详细分析流程:1) 收集交易ID、链路trace与网关日志;2) 重现场景并做分段压测;3) 用分布式追踪定位耗时/失败点;4) 检查外部依赖(证书、限额、风控策略);5) 修复并回归测试,发布灰度并监控SLI/SLO。

结论:通过端到端追踪、Golang高并发实现、流式智能平台与严格审计,可从根本上提高TPWallet的闪兑稳定性与可观测性,既保障用户体验亦满足合规要求。

参考文献:[1] PCI Security Standards Council; [2] ISO 20022 / NIST guidance; [3] Martin Kleppmann, Designing Data-Intensive Applications; [4] Go官方并发模式文档; [5] NIST SP 800 系列。

请选择或投票(多选或投票):

1. 我愿意先从监控与追踪入手;

2. 我倾向先做压力测试与性能优化;

3. 我希望优先检查第三方清算与证书;

4. 我需要团队做完整审计与合规评估。

作者:陈亦峰发布时间:2026-01-17 21:24:55

评论

LiWei

文章结构清晰,建议把风控白名单策略单独列出。

张婷

结合Flink的实时ETL思路很实用,已经收藏。

AlexChen

Golang+gRPC的建议我会在下次版本迭代中采纳。

用户123

关于审计的不可变日志部分想看更多实施细节。

相关阅读